As an alternative, BMSC have already been proven to secrete elements which promote neurogenesis and suppress inflammation, maximizing endogenous recovery. In mouse products of stroke, BMSC are demonstrated to migrate to ischemic disorders wherever they consequently upregulate creation of neurotrophins and expansion aspects which can be related to neurorestoration as well as observed therapeutic benefits (Qu et al., 2007). BMSC engineered to overexpress neurotrophic components have also been shown to reinforce recovery, supporting the function of BMSC-derived things as the principal system of therapeutic advantage (Horita et al., 2006).

When embryonic tissue has been the primary source of hNPC, endeavours are also under method to use induced pluripotent stem cells to produce hNPC. In rat designs of stroke, induced human neural progenitor cells (ihNPC) have already been shown to form purposeful neurons and make improvements to recovery pursuing stroke (Oki et al., 2012). Not long ago, Tornero et al. demonstrated that neurons derived from hiNPC grafts obtained immediate synaptic inputs from host neurons in designs similar to corresponding endogenous neurons in the intact Mind, suggesting hiNPC lead to functional recovery from stroke through immediate contribution of new neurons (Tornero et al.
